3. Important Characteristics Cont. Lubrication-Minimize shearing action of two surfaces between which relative motion exists Hydrodynamic lubrication-Sufficient fluid is forced between mating surfaces to insure they do not touch Boundary layer lubrication – Fluid used to partially separate surfaces and to minimize galling or welding of high contact stress points (phosphate esters allow new surfaces to form with lower melting temperature and redistribution of material)
